Stigmella floslactella (Haworth, 1828)

Food Plant: Carpinus (Hornbeam), Corylus (Hazel) Egg: Underside of leaf Mine: June - July, September - October Notes: The early gallery is filled with frass, later leaving clear margins. The larva is a dull yellow, head pale brown (as shown). Data: Lancashire Image:© Ian Kimber |
